EPA Rules Impacting Steel Industry Draw Scrutiny

A bipartisan group of U.S. senators, including Ohio’s U.S. Sens. Sherrod Brown (D) and JD Vance (R), is urging the U.S. EPA to reconsider three proposed emissions-related rules.

Brown says the rules “would dramatically undermine America’s steel industry.” OMA-member Cleveland-Cliffs has made comments in support of the senators’ request, reports say.

Earlier this year, the OMA testified before the U.S. EPA to challenge the agency’s proposals targeting iron and steel manufacturing.
